Bar Charts and Beyond

The bar chart—perhaps the quintessential data visualization tool—remains an enduring favorite. These simple, horizontal or vertical bars clearly display comparisons between discrete categories. They excel at comparing data for different groups over time or showing the distribution of a certain attribute across categories. But there’s sophistication even within the bar chart, with variations like stacked, grouped, and 100% stacked charts catering to a range of analytical needs.

Line charts, on the other hand, can depict trends over time, capturing the ebb and flow of data. They offer a visual narrative that’s perfect for time-series analysis, illustrating changes and their rate of change more than bar charts do.

Pie charts, with their charming ability to encapsulate a whole within a single circle, are excellent for showing proportions. However, they have been criticized for misrepresenting data due to their inability to accurately reflect differences in magnitude, especially when there are many segments and the wedges are very small.

Bubble charts elevate the visualization game by plotting data in three dimensions, using bubble size to represent a third variable, often adding an extra layer of information to what bar and line charts can showcase.

Grids of bar charts, also known as mosaic plots or trellis charts, divide the data into conditional segments to reveal patterns across multiple variables. This type of visualization is highly effective for complex data that would otherwise become overwhelming in a simpler graph.

The Art of the Scatter Plot

Moving beyond the structured lines and bars are scatter plots, which are masterpieces of simplicity and revelation. They use points to represent individual data points, with axes scaling in the same or different units, allowing for a comprehensive comparison of two quantitative variables. Scatter plots are the foundation of statistical analysis and have been pivotal in uncovering relationships between variables, from correlations in social science to causal linkages in biological research.

These plots can become more sophisticated with additional features, such as adding lines of best fit (regression lines) to interpret trends or coloring the data points based on a third variable to enhance understanding.

Word Clouds: When Text Meets Visualization

If data is the heart of visualization, text is the soul. Word clouds bring together the power of data and the breadth of human language. These visually stunning representations allow us to perceive the frequency and prominence of words at a glance, encapsulating themes and sentiment in a powerful and evocative way.

Word clouds are not just decorative; they can be revealing, from highlighting significant topics in a corpus to assessing public opinion in real-time. Through their use of font size, color, and shape, word clouds convey much more than just counting words; they tell a narrative, often reflecting biases and emotions underlying the text.

Maps in the Digital Age

In a globalized world, maps are invaluable for illustrating geographic distributions and patterns. Interactive maps allow us to delve into spatial data, providing a rich context for global trends. They can show everything from the spread of a particular virus to the migration patterns of a species or the popularity of a product.

Heat maps take this a step further, using intensity gradients to show how various factors vary across a range of variables, such as the concentration of precipitation in different regions or the level of crime reported across a city.
